Bearded Ohio hip-hopper Stalley has made his new album, ‘Lincoln Way Nights (Intelligent Trunk Music)’, available for free via his Bandcamp page. Produced by Rashad Thomas, the record was originally pencilled in for an October 2010 release. It’s a hit and miss affair (he could have done with shaving three or four tracks off the sixteen), but there are enough highlights to maintain interest, including today’s MPFree, ‘Hard’.
